This here is a Dan Wesson 357 magnum I inherited from a late uncle. I'm not sure since I don't have any paperwork for it, but I think it's from about 1971 based on some sniffing around on the internet. When I got it, it was in pretty bad shape from rusting away in an attic for a few decades and needed a good cleaning. I've taken it to the range a few times and made thunder and lightning happen. This thing definitely earns that stereotypical nickname of a "handcannon." That recoil is gnarly as fuck and the flash makes it look like a goddamned flamethrower.
Overall, it's cool to own and have as a show-and-tell piece, but I definitely prefer a modern pistol.

Rep. Pat Harrigan, R-N.C., a former Army Green Beret who served in Afghanistan, introduced a bill in April to let current and former members of the special operations forces carry concealed weapons across state lines. The bill would grant authorized users national ID cards, and is modeled after a law that lets retired law enforcement carry firearms nationwide.
